扫一扫
分享文章到微信
扫一扫
关注官方公众号
至顶头条
作者:Lotus Notes/Domino探索 来源:blog.csdn.net 2007年9月12日
关键字: Domino
在本页阅读全文(共19页)
4. Start now!
在开始之前,先让我们来搭建一个简单的实验环境:两台server,两个client,结构如下,
在这个实验中,我们为Secondary server 和Notes Client分别配置“Automatic diagnostic Collection”,来收集他们crash的信息。
4.1 收集client crash的数据
要为client配置“Automatic diagnostic Collection”,需要使用desktop policy工具。在进行policy配置之前,我们需要先讲一点desktop policy的知识。
(一)Desktop policy工作原理介绍:
Desktop policy是用来集中管理和更新用户desktop workplace的工具。desktop policy的工作原理是:
首先,由管理员讲desktop policy分配给用户,可以是某几个用户,也可以是某个组织单元下的所有用户。
然后,作为用户,使用notes client访问domino server的时候,会接收这些policy文档到本地的地址本中。
最后,Domino或其他的应用程序将扫描用户本地地址本的desktop policy文档,并对用户的Notes Client进行更新。
注意,要想使policy生效需要保证Notes Client只有一个用户在使用。这样,该用户在连接到server时,才能接收到分配给他的desktop policy。
1. 创建desktop settings文档,并完成如下设置:
Basic Tab
域名 值 说明
Name ADCol Desktop Settings的名字
Description Automatic Diagnostic collection settings 对这个Desktop Settings文档的简单描述。
Diagnostics Tab
域名 值 说明
Mail-in database for diagnostic reports Lotus Notes/Domino Fault Reports 选择接收诊断报告的mail-in数据库。
Prompt user to send diagnostic report Yes 提示用户,在client crash后,是否要发送诊断报告。
Prompt user for comments Yes 为用户显示一个提示框,用来输入他们在client crash的时候作了什么操作。
Maximum size of diagnostic message including attachments (in MB) 5 诊断消息的总大小。
Maximum size of NSD output to attach (in MB) 2 附加到message中的NSD文件的大小。
Maximum amount of console output file to attach (in KB) 10240 发送到报告中的console输出文件的大小。
Diagnostic file patterns: 你希望附加在报告中的文件的某一部分。如addin*.log。
Remove diagnostic files after a specified number of days Yes 删除多少天之前的诊断信息。
Number of days to keep diagnostic files 365 设置保留多少天的诊断信息。
2. 创建desktop policy文档,并完成如下设置:
Basics Tab
其他域设置保持原有不变。
3. 分配desktop policy给用户Tester1/Acme7。
4. 作为Tester1启动Notes client,并连接到server: Hub/Acme7。
现在,需要测试我们的配置是否成功。
5. Make your Notes Client Crash.
6. 重启Notes client,你将会看到Fault诊断报告,并且提示你,是否需要发送该报告。如图:
7. 选择"Send Report",发送该诊断报告。
注意,在真实的工作环境中,用户只需要发送那些他们认为有必要让管理员关注的fault报告。其他的问题,直接选择"Don't Send"。
8. 接着,系统将提示用户提供在client crash时,用户作了哪些操作。如图:
OK,报告发送成功,现在,让我们看看作为管理员该作什么了。
9. 作为管理员,打开Lotus Notes/Domino Fault Reports (lndfr.nsf)数据库,进入Client -> Standard view。在这里,管理员可以看到所有接收到的Client Crash的诊断报告。如图:
10. 打开诊断报告,可以收集到的有关Crash的文件,包括一些NSD文件、diagindex文件、和其他一些信息。如图:
好了,Automatic Diagnostic Collection工具已经完成了它收集Notes Client Crash信息的任务。那么如何收集server crash数据呢?且听下回分解,*^_^*
Trackback: http://tb.blog.csdn.net/TrackBack.aspx?PostId=1534075
如果您非常迫切的想了解IT领域最新产品与技术信息,那么订阅至顶网技术邮件将是您的最佳途径之一。